Well, I'm partial to the Smith and Wesson M&P 9mm Compact. There might be some used ones for sale depending on where you go. Used pistols are as good as brand new in my opinion and if money is tight it's a good option.
A small semi-automatic in 9mm of any brand will be useful in a Door Dash situation where you are getting in and out of a car all the time.
I'm not saying _just_ the M&P, get one that feels good in your hand. One good thing to try is finding a local range that rents pistols and trying out a couple of them. A pistol that you don't like shooting will become a pistol you never practice with and that's not a good thing.
